Opportunity description


The World Academy of Science (TWAS) awards nine individual scientists living in developing countries prizes of $15,000. This year, TWAS is looking for new nominees to award. Nominees must have lived the past 10 years in developing countries and are scientists meeting at least one of the following qualifications:
[1] Scientific research achievement of outstanding significance for the development of scientific thought.
[2] Outstanding contribution to the application of science and technology to sustainable development.

Self nominations are not accepted. Nominators must provide their contact information along with the nominee’s contact information. Nominations must also include the degrees obtained and a list of 12 most significant publications listed in an internationally acceptable format.The names of awardees will be announced on the first day of the TWAS 14th  General Conference and 28th General Meeting to be held in November 2018. The winners will be invited to receive their award and give a talk the following year.
